    I have the naga epic (thats the wireless one) and i love the hell out of it!! One thing i do have to say and it sounds retarded...if you have it plugged in make sure you switch it to OFF. otherwise it is trying to be wireless and will kill the battery. Doesnt matter if you are using it wired when the battery dies the mouse stops. Took me a week of fighting with "a terrible mouse" before i realized this and it has since been the best mouse i have ever used. The ability to bind so much so easily and close to each other is amazing.

    not bashing razer yet, but what do you need 12 buttons for? there are 105 of them on a standard keyboard, and every class in wow can be broken down to 5 primary buttons, which fit perfectly on 1-5, there is also 6-0, f1-f4, f5-f8 r, t, f, g, a, d, for secondary spells, and dont forget the tilda key

    if you learn to play with those, you never have to worry about what happens when your mouse dies, it also means you can use any mouse and keyboard you like
